There might be a laundry pile taunting you.

There might be a to-do list screaming at you.

There might be a sink filled with dirty dishes mocking you.

There might be a teenager’s room frightening you.

There might be a cranky preschooler hanging onto her favorite parent’s leg.

photo

There might be all of the above.

Because life is messy. It can be hard and unfair. It can be brilliant and beautiful. It can be all of these at the same time. But no matter what kind of mess you’re staring down today, you can say yes.

God doesn’t wait for us to perfect our life before He asks us to obey. He doesn’t wait for us to have it all together, to clean up our act, to finally arrive before He asks.

This is my story.

I didn’t know where my yes would lead. We never do. And I never expected it to change my life. But it always does. I didn’t believe I was enough–good enough, smart enough. I’m not. But He is.

Don’t wait to do what God is telling you. And if you don’t know where to start–

Start with yes.
Say yes in your mess (your sink, your laundry, your life) today. Because where you are today-is an important place.
